Creating Corporate Sustainability: Gender as an Agent for Change
Beate Sjafjell-Irene Lynch Fannon
A group of female scholars led by two established academics consider sustainability, corporate action, corporate ethics, corporate governance and the role of gender in these contexts. This book will appeal to scholars, thought leaders and policymakers interested in corporate law theory, sustainability issues and feminist theory.
